Ravens waive cornerback Victor Hampton

A day after his arrest was reported, the Ravens cut the young corner.

The Ravens sure didn't take long to react.

A day after it was reported that reserve cornerback Victor Hampton was arrested and charged for a DWI in North Carolina, the Ravens announced that he's been waived from the offseason roster. Though Hampton wasn't expected to do anything more than participate during offseason activities and training camp, this can be chalked up to a serious opportunity squandered for the NFL hopeful.

Hampton initially signed with the Bengals as an undrafted free agent out of South Carolina but ended his 2014 season as a member of the Giants' practice squad. However, the Giants elected not to sign him to a reserve/futures deal.

According to Charlotte's WSOC TV, Hampton was charged with a DWI after being pulled over for going 100 mph in a 55 mph zone.

The report also states that a trooper noticed two passengers hiding firearms as he approached the vehicle.
